Leroy Merlin do various grades of AG some friends of ours purchased some from LR M to lay on their solarium, it looked ok for about 6 months, you really need the experts to lay it for you, it's like laying a carpet, without the right equipment it can take ages. The edges have shrunk away from each other so the tiles are showing through, it might have saved money doing it themselves but....asethetically it leaves a lot to be desired.
